bam Dictionary Entry

bam

Part of Speech

Interjection, Noun, Verb

Pronunciation

bæm

Definitions

  1. Interjection: Used to represent a sudden, sharp, or explosive noise, typically associated with a loud impact or event.
  2. Noun: A loud, sharp noise or sound, often indicating something sudden or dramatic.
  3. Verb: To hit or strike something with a sharp, sudden impact, often associated with a loud noise.

Usage Examples

  • The door slammed shut with a loud "bam!"
  • He bam'd the hammer onto the nail with great force.
  • She heard the bam of the explosion from miles away.

Etymology

The word "bam" is an onomatopoeic word, representing the sound of a sudden, loud noise, typically an impact or explosion. It has been in use since the early 19th century in both the literal and figurative senses.

Historical Usage

First recorded in the early 19th century, the word "bam" was primarily used to describe the sound of a sudden, loud impact or explosion. It became more widely used as an interjection to signify the dramatic nature of an event.

Cultural Nuances

"Bam" has evolved into an expression of surprise or dramatic action, commonly used in comic books and movies to denote intense action or a sudden event. It is often seen in exaggerated depictions of physical actions like punches or crashes.

More Information

The word "bam" is part of a larger family of onomatopoeic words that replicate sudden noises, often associated with action or impact. It is commonly used in comic book sound effects, where it portrays dramatic events like punches or explosions. In addition, "bam" is frequently used in everyday speech to emphasize the intensity of something, as in "And then, bam! Everything changed." The simplicity and versatility of this word make it an effective tool for representing impactful moments in both written and spoken forms.
